Stop Options: Óbidos & Nazaré
Travelers exploring the Transfer Tour Porto/Lisbon with stops at Óbidos and Nazaré are in for a delightful journey filled with rich historical experiences and breathtaking natural wonders.
Óbidos, known for its well-preserved medieval walls and charming cobblestone streets, offers a glimpse into Portugal’s past. Visitors can indulge in the local cuisine, such as the famous Ginjinha cherry liqueur. The town is dotted with cultural landmarks like the Óbidos Castle, providing insights into its fascinating history.
Moving on to Nazaré, a coastal gem famed for its giant waves and picturesque beaches, travelers can savor fresh seafood dishes and explore the cultural richness of this fishing village.
Both stops promise a blend of history, culinary delights, and stunning scenery for an enriching travel experience.

Tour Highlights
Set out on a captivating journey through Porto and Lisbon with stops in Óbidos, Nazaré, Fátima, and Coimbra, enjoying the rich culture and beauty of these destinations.
Explore architecture dating back centuries in Óbidos, a picturesque town enclosed by medieval walls. Witness the breathtaking views of Nazaré, known for its giant waves and traditional fishing heritage.
Experience the spiritual ambiance of Fátima, a renowned pilgrimage site with historic religious significance. In Coimbra, explore Portugal’s academic heritage by visiting one of the oldest universities in the world.
Each stop offers unique cultural experiences, from cobblestone streets to ancient monuments, providing a diverse and enriching tour for travelers seeking a deeper understanding of Portugal’s history and traditions.
